How to Tell When You Should Call a Roof Company?

What signs might a homeowner determine as the perfect occasion to reach out to a roofing contractor? Recognizing the symptoms of roofing issues proves indispensable for caring for a sound and functional home. Home dwellers ought to pay attention to for missing, fractured, or twisted shingles, which indicate conceivable harm. In addition, marks from water on ceilings or inside walls could suggest water seepage needing quick attention. A sagging roof outline constitutes another substantial alert, often revealing structural issues at the base.

Moreover, increased energy bills can signal poor thermal protection or inadequate ventilation caused by roof problems. Consistent reviews following intense weather events such as storms or heavy snowfall are important to catch any emerging issues in a timely manner. If any of these warning signs are observed, it is advisable to get in touch with a experienced roofing contractor to evaluate the circumstances and recommend required repairs or replacements. Prompt measures can stop extra damage and guarantee the longevity of the roof.

Types of Roof Coverings and Their Longevity

In reviewing roofing choices, different materials offer specific advantages pertaining to durability. Asphalt shingles, recognized for their cost-effectiveness, deliver a dependable solution, while metal roofing presents enhanced longevity and resistance to severe weather. Additionally, tile roofing is lauded for its impressive durability, making it a valuable selection for homeowners seeking lasting protection.

Asphalt Shingles Overview

Many property owners prefer asphalt shingles due to their combination of affordability and durability. These shingles, made primarily of asphalt and fiberglass, provide a versatile roofing solution. They come in a range of styles and colors, enabling homeowners to personalize their roofs to match their visual preferences. The average lifespan of asphalt shingles extends from 15 to 30 years, depending on the quality and installation. Additionally, they perform well in various weather conditions, withstanding wind and rain effectively. Maintenance is fairly straightforward, often requiring only periodic inspections and cleaning. As a commonly employed roofing material, asphalt shingles also provide good fire resistance, contributing to their appeal among homeowners seeking dependable and budget-friendly roofing options.

Metal Roof Advantages

While many property owners seek longevity in roofing materials, metal roofing stands out as an exceptional choice. Recognized for its remarkable longevity, metal roofs can last 40 to 70 years, significantly outpacing conventional choices like asphalt shingles. They are impervious to a range of we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, and wind, making them perfect for diverse climates. Additionally, metal roofing bounces back solar heat, contributing to energy efficiency and lowering cooling costs. Its lightweight nature allows for easier installation and less structural strain. Available in a range of styles and colors, metal roofs also improve a home's visual appearance. With reduced maintenance requirements, metal roofing proves to be a smart investment for homeowners emphasizing durability and sustainability.

Tile Strength Findings

Tile roofing provides another durable alternative for property owners looking for enduring options. Recognized for its durability, tile roofing can resist harsh weather conditions, such as strong sunlight, heavy rain, and powerful winds. Concrete and clay tiles are the widely common types, each providing distinct benefits. Clay tiles are fire-resistant and can last over 100 years, while concrete tiles offer cost-effectiveness and flexibility in design. Both types require minimal maintenance and are immune to rot and insects. Additionally, tile roofing aids to energy conservation by reflecting sunlight, lowering cooling costs. However, it is essential to examine the weight of tile roofing, as it may demand extra structural support. Overall, tile roofing remains a smart choice for longevity and longevity.

Assessing Roofing Projects: Essential Quality Metrics

When assessing the quality of roofing work, several key indicators emerge that can greatly impact a project's durability and performance. First, the materials used must meet professional guidelines; high-quality materials guarantee durability and withstand environmental stressors. Second, the installation technique is vital; improper installation can lead to leaks and structural issues, regardless of material quality. Third, careful consideration in flashing and sealing can prevent water intrusion, a common cause of damage.

Furthermore, the presence of proper ventilation is crucial, as it helps in regulating thermal levels and moisture within the roofing system. Finally, a credible contractor will furnish protections for both products and workmanship, conveying assurance in their services. By evaluating these markers, property owners can make informed decisions about the quality of roofing work and its ramifications on their investment.

How long Does a Standard Roofing Project Take to Finish?

A conventional roofing project usually takes around one to three weeks to complete. Considerations affecting the timeframe include roof scale, materials utilized, weather conditions, and the complexity of the installation process.

What Coverage Do Roofing Contractors Usually Provide on Their Work?

Roofing contractors typically offer warranties from 5 to 30 years, dependent on the materials used and the complexity of the project. These guarantees commonly address material and workmanship defects, ensuring extended safeguarding for clients.

What payment alternatives Are obtainable for roof repairs?

Many roofing contractors present financing options, including installment options, financial products, and credit lines. These options can help residents reduce financial burden in a more practical manner, making roof work more accessible without undermining quality or required maintenance.

How Do I Keep My Roof in Proper Shape Post-Installation?

To preserve a roof after installation, regular inspections for debris and damage are critical. Cleaning gutters, inspecting flashing, and ensuring adequate ventilation can prevent issues, prolonging the roof's lifespan and maintaining its integrity.

What Precautions Must I Take if I Notice Roof Leaks?

After noticing roof leaks, the individual should promptly inspect for noticeable harm, check gutters, and sweep away blockages. Engaging a professional for a thorough assessment and necessary repairs secures sustained preservation and circumvents further construction deterioration.
